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9098 44080339 32613486 24917385020 41
135 1097
135 1097
75617766163 254 097387 634
All about undefined
Interested in learning more?
135 1097
75617766163 254 097387 634
See more
341328981 03817565536
26154375 992 35624070 661651901
See more
545101624 59477289 0054
9299 087728829 0629048013
See more